What affects the price of a bus rental?

Vehicle size is the biggest lever — a 56-passenger charter bus costs more per hour than a 20-passenger minibus, and a party bus with a full bar and LED lighting typically runs higher than a standard coach of the same capacity. Beyond the vehicle, the date and day of the week matter: Friday and Saturday evenings in Miami Beach price higher than Sunday through Thursday, and peak periods like Art Basel in early December, Ultra Music Festival in March, and spring break in late March drive rates up across the board. Route length, number of stops, total service hours, and how far out you book all factor in too — the closer you are to a high-demand date, the tighter the availability and the firmer the pricing.

What is the smartest way to get the lowest rate for my Miami Beach group?

Book as far out as you can — three to six months ahead gives you the widest vehicle selection and the most competitive pricing. If your dates are flexible, Sunday through Thursday typically prices lower than Friday and Saturday in Miami Beach, where weekend nightlife demand keeps evening rates elevated year-round. Starting earlier in the day and consolidating your stops into a tighter itinerary reduces total service hours, which brings the rate down.

And right-sizing the vehicle matters: booking a 56-passenger coach for 30 people means paying for empty seats when a 35-passenger minibus would do the job for less.

What are the busiest times of year for group transportation in Miami Beach, and when should we book?

Miami Beach runs at peak demand from mid-December through mid-April, when the weather draws visitors from across the country and events stack up fast. Art Basel Miami Beach in early December fills buses days in advance. Ultra Music Festival and spring break together make late March one of the tightest windows of the year.

The Miami Open in mid-to-late March adds another surge. Wedding season peaks in the fall and again in the spring, and prom and graduation weekends in April and May book out quickly across Miami-Dade County. For any of those dates, three to six months ahead is the practical target — six months or more if you need a specific vehicle type.

Last-minute requests are always worth submitting because availability shifts, but expect fewer options and higher rates the closer you get.

Which buses have a bathroom?

Onboard restrooms are most commonly found on full-size charter buses and may include them — minibuses and school buses generally do not. Because availability varies by vehicle and provider, no restroom can be guaranteed until the booking is confirmed. If an onboard restroom is a requirement for your trip, state it when you submit your details so the results page can filter toward vehicles that are more likely to have one.

Which buses have room for luggage?

Full-size charter buses are the only vehicle class with dedicated undercarriage storage bays, making them the right call for groups traveling with significant baggage. Some minibus configurations include a rear luggage compartment, though others trade that space for additional passenger seats — it varies by build. Party buses give up nearly all storage to lounge seating and bar space, and school buses have none to speak of.

One practical note: a vehicle filled to its passenger rating has very little room left for bags regardless of class, so factor luggage volume into your headcount and vehicle choice from the start.

Can I rent a wheelchair accessible bus?

Accessible vehicles can be requested — state lift or ramp requirements, the number of wheelchair positions needed, and your total seated passenger count when you submit your trip details. Each wheelchair position replaces standard passenger seats, so the overall seating capacity of an accessible vehicle is lower than the same model in a standard configuration. Availability of ADA-accessible vehicles varies by city and vehicle class, so the earlier you submit the request, the better the chance of finding the right fit for your group.

Which airports serve Miami Beach, and how does group transportation work when flying in?

Miami International Airport (MIA) is the primary gateway, roughly 9 to 12 miles from the center of Miami Beach — a drive that runs 20 to 35 minutes in normal traffic and can stretch to an hour or more on a Friday afternoon when I-195 or the MacArthur Causeway backs up.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port (FLL) is about 30 miles north, typically 35 to 55 minutes depending on I-95 and US-1 conditions. A charter bus or minibus may be arranged for curbside pickup at the arrivals level once everyone has cleared baggage claim — confirm the specific door and terminal with the booking platform when you finalize your reservation, since both airports designate specific pickup zones for pre-arranged ground transportation.

Where do groups actually get picked up and dropped off in Miami Beach?

Most hotel-based pickups happen along Collins Avenue between 17th and 44th Streets, where the major resort properties have dedicated motor coach pull-through areas or marked curbside loading zones. The Lincoln Road pedestrian mall and the blocks immediately east on Washington Avenue are popular drop-off points for evening groups, though a full-size coach cannot stage on Lincoln Road itself — nearby side streets like 17th Street or Alton Road are the practical staging areas. For events at the Miami Beach Convention Center (1901 Convention Center Dr, Miami Beach, FL 33139), buses use the designated drop-off lanes on the Convention Center Drive side.

Confirm staging details with your venue before the trip, since enforcement of oversized-vehicle restrictions on South Beach streets is active year-round.

What are the real places groups book transportation to in Miami Beach?

Concert and event crowds head to FPL Solar Amphitheater at Bayfront Park (301 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33132) and the Fillmore Miami Beach (1700 Washington Ave, Miami Beach, FL 33139), where bus service can bring the group to the venue instead of hunting for metered parking on Washington Avenue after the show. Wedding groups travel to The Betsy Hotel (1440 Ocean Dr, Miami Beach, FL 33139), 1 Hotel South Beach (2341 Collins Ave, Miami Beach, FL 33139), and Villa Woodbine in Coconut Grove. Nightlife groups build itineraries through LIV at Fontainebleau (4441 Collins Ave), STORY (136 Collins Ave), and E11EVEN Miami (29 NE 11th St, Miami).

Convention attendees shuttle between hotels and the Miami Beach Convention Center. These are examples — a group can go anywhere in the region.

What local traffic and timing factors should my group plan around in Miami Beach?

The MacArthur Causeway (I-395) and the Julia Tuttle Causeway (I-195) are the two main arteries connecting Miami Beach to the mainland, and both back up significantly on Friday afternoons, Saturday evenings, and any morning following a major event. During Ultra Music Festival in late March, Biscayne Boulevard and the causeways can see closures and restricted access around Bayfront Park for hours before and after performances. Art Basel weekend in early December turns the entire South Beach grid into gridlock by early evening.

A full-size charter bus also needs more lead time to stage and load than a car — South Beach's narrow side streets and many private garages cannot accommodate a 40-foot coach at all, so confirm your pickup point's clearance before the trip date.

Can a bus pick up my group at multiple hotels along Collins Avenue on the same run?

Multi-hotel pickup runs can be requested and are common for Miami Beach wedding and convention groups. The practical consideration is time: each additional stop on Collins Avenue adds 10 to 20 minutes to the pickup window depending on traffic, pedestrian crossings, and how quickly passengers load — and on a Saturday evening in season, the blocks between 17th and 44th Streets can move slowly. Build that buffer into your itinerary when you submit the request, and list every hotel address and pickup order so the booking platform can price the route accurately.

If your group spans both ends of the beach, a tighter pickup window on the north end before working south tends to flow better than the reverse.
